1. Hydration: The Golden Key to Gut Health 💧🔑

First things first, hydration is your gut’s best friend. Drinking plenty of water isn’t just about quenching thirst – it’s essential for flushing out toxins and keeping your digestive tract moving smoothly. Aim for at least eight glasses a day, and if you’re feeling extra adventurous, try adding lemon slices or cucumber for a refreshing twist. 🍋🥒

2. Fiber: The Natural Detoxifier 🍎🥦

Think of fiber as nature’s broom, sweeping away waste and keeping your gut clean. Foods rich in soluble and insoluble fiber, like fruits, vegetables, and whole grains, help regulate digestion and promote regular bowel movements. So next time you’re at the grocery store, load up on those colorful veggies and whole grain breads. 🥗🍞

3. Probiotics: The Good Gut Bacteria 🦠🌿

Probiotics are the superheroes of your digestive system, fighting off bad bacteria and promoting a healthy gut microbiome. Incorporating probiotic-rich foods like yogurt, kefir, and sauerkraut into your diet can boost your gut health naturally. And don’t forget to balance them with prebiotics found in foods like bananas and onions to feed these beneficial bacteria. 🍌🧅

4. The Role of Exercise: Moving to Cleanse 🏋️‍♂️💪

Exercise isn’t just for toning muscles – it’s also great for your gut. Regular physical activity helps stimulate digestion and promotes regularity. So, whether it’s a brisk walk around the neighborhood or a high-intensity workout session, getting active can do wonders for your gut health. Plus, it’s a great way to clear your head and reduce stress. 🌈🧘‍♀️
